Summary
In a fairly light week for economic news we have seen the UK markets dominated by mergers and acquisitions talks. So far this week we have seen three major British companies receive takeover approaches as well as the independent directors at Cardiff based- Peacock Group agreeing to a pounds 404m management buyout.
